Membrane Electrostatics Sensed by Tryptophan Anchors in Hydrophobic Model Peptides Depends on Non-Aromatic Interfacial Amino Acids: Implications in Hydrophobic Mismatch Faraday Discuss. (IF 3.797) Pub Date : 2020-09-21 Sreetama Pal; Roger E. Koeppe II; Amitabha Chattopadhyay
WALPs are synthetic α-helical membrane-spanning peptides that constitute a well-studied system for exploring hydrophobic mismatch. These peptides represent a simplified consensus motif for transmembrane domains of intrinsic membrane proteins due to their hydrophobic core of alternating leucine and alanine flanked by membrane-anchoring aromatic tryptophan residues. Caveolin Induced Membrane Curvature and Lipid Clustering: Two Sides of the Same Coin? Faraday Discuss. (IF 3.797) Pub Date : 2020-09-17 Shikha Prakash; Anjali Krishna; Durba Sengupta
Caveolin-1 (cav-1) is a multi-domain membrane protein that is a key player in cell signaling, endocytosis and mechanoprotection. It is the principle component of cholesterol-rich caveolar domains and has been reported to induce membrane curvature. Order-disorder transitions of cytoplasmic N-termini in the mechanisms of P-type ATPases Faraday Discuss. (IF 3.797) Pub Date : 2020-09-01 Khondker Rufaka Hossain; Daniel Clayton; Sophia C Goodchild; Alison Rodger; Richard James Payne; Flemming Cornelius; Ronald James Clarke
Membrane protein structure and function are modulated via interactions with their lipid environment. This is particularly true for the integral membrane pumps, the P-type ATPases. Controllable membrane remodeling by a modified fragment of the apoptotic protein Bax Faraday Discuss. (IF 3.797) Pub Date : 2020-09-01 Katherine G. Schaefer; Brayan Grau; Nicolas Moore; Ismael Mingarro; Gavin King; Francisco Barrera
Intrinsic apoptosis is orchestrated by a group of proteins that mediate the coordinated disruption of mitochondrial membranes. Bax is a multi-domain protein that, upon activation, disrupts the integrity of the mitochondrial outer membrane by forming pores. Lipid specificity of the immune effector perforin Faraday Discuss. (IF 3.797) Pub Date : 2020-08-13 Adrian W Hodel; Jesse Rudd-Schmidt; Joseph A Trapani; Ilia Voskoboinik; Bart Hoogenboom
Perforin is a pore forming protein used by cytotoxic T lymphocytes to remove cancerous or virus-infected cells during immune response. During the response, the lymphocyte membrane becomes refractory to perforin function by accumulating densely ordered lipid rafts and externalizing negatively charged lipid species.
